A 400 m long train takes 36 s to cross a man walking at 20 km/h in the direction opposite to that of the train. What is the speed of the train?

Answer
Correct Answer: 20 km/h
Explanation
Relative speed of train = 400/36 m/s = 400/36 x (18/5) = 40 km/h Relative speed of train = Speed of train + Speed of man ⇒ 40 = Speed of train + 20 ∴ Speed of train = 40 - 20 = 20 km/h
